Very smart cylindrical glass jars with fingerprint resistant bonded plastic outer and screw top plastic lid. This set of three (black) canisters each has a one litre capacity and measures 10cm (4") diameter and 17.5cm (6.75") tall. An elliptical cut out panel in the plastic outer allows contents to be easily seen.Each canister weighs 720g when empty and feels nicely balanced and solid in the hand. The screw top lid is well made.Each canister comfortably holds 40 - 60 teabags (will take 80 at a push).Will hold up to 250g coffee granules.Will hold up to 750g granulated sugar.A canister will also comfortably hold up to ten of the taller Kenco or similar brand Latte or Cappucino sachets, or the tall single sized sachets of hot chocolate drink.My other half has just said, "You didn't actually count and measure how many teabags and stuff you can put in one of them, did you?"
